The sign for "washing machine" shows the agitating action of a washing machine. It can
mean "do laundry." I've also seen people sign "DISH WASHING-MACHINE"
to mean "dishwasher."
WASHING-MACHINE (wash-in-machine) laundry




Sample sentence: Do you like doing laundry? / Do you like washing clothes?
(CLOTHES, YOU LIKE WASH-in-machine?)
